**Q: Why is the Larkspur ORM refactor blocked on the credentials vault?**

The legacy mapping layer in Larkspur still reads its schema-migration lock from the old Brindlewood vault, which was sealed during the Q2 cutover. Until we re-key it, migrations against the staging replica will fail silently. To unseal the vault during the refactor window, use the recovery passphrase below.

vault phrase of tajeg-tageg = pelix-druix-holius-briael-zorwyn-frawyn-fraox-norok-drueth-aldiel

**Handover: calendar sync conflict (Meridian Scheduler)**

Welcome aboard! Before I head out: there's a known conflict where Tillman's sync worker and the webhook listener both try to reconcile recurring events, so edits occasionally double-apply. We mitigated it by narrowing the sync window and disabling eager reconciliation. Don't revert that without talking to Osei first. The sync worker currently runs with these settings:

config for kafof-bawef:
holath:
  log_level: debug
  metrics_host: metrics.holath.qorvelsys.internal
  pin: 2191
  pool_size: 32

## Further reading

Firmware for Bramblehatch devices ships over the `stable` and `canary` channels. Canary auto-promotes after 72 hours without a rollback signal. On-call: never force-promote during a fleet sync window. Rollbacks are channel-wide, not per-device, so confirm blast radius first. Channel states, promotion history, and the kill switch are documented on the internal page directly below.

operations page: https://jenkins.zemvarcloud.local/job/merge_requests/repo/build/73930b4b30f0a8ed

Ticket: Skylark pricing experiment (variant C, dynamic tier discounts) ready to ship behind the flag. Metrics wired into Dashlane-Q board. Risk: revenue dip if rollout exceeds 10% cohort. Needs sign-off before Thursday's release train. Blocking the Vexbridge checkout refactor until approved. The approver whose sign-off is required is named below.

approver of bagug-bagag = Holael Pramir